leukemia and flying
I am planning to fly to UK, have had leukemia (CML) for 6 years, my oncologist says is is fine to fly but I am worried about alltitude not making my leukemia worse please help
Dear Maria
the airplanes have controlled cabin pressure so the altitude won't affect you at all.
